If you apply outland, you send the complete application (sponsor forms, applicant forms, and the country-specific forms) to Mississauga. They will check the application and then send it to the processing office for Vietnam, which is Singapore. To check the processing times, check for Vietnam. However, if you have a complete application with a lot of evidence that your relationship is genuine, it should be done well before the time listed.

Ordinarily if there is an interview for an outland application, it will not be held in Canada.

One of the advantages of inland is that you can get an open work permit with it. Since you already have an open work permit, this is not a consideration for you really. One disadvantage of inland is that the applicant is advised not to leave the country during processing. You can leave, but if you are not let back in, the application is over. Since you have a multiple-entry visa, you would probably be let back in, but it is not a sure thing.

I would go with outland, simply because the processing time is generally much faster. In addition, you do not need the work permit one can get applying inland.
